The open.mp logo
Home
FAQ
Forums
Servers
Partners
Docs
Blog

warning Not Translated

This page has not been translated into the language that your browser requested yet. The English content is being shown as a fallback.

If you want to contribute a translation for this page then please click here.

SetPlayerObjectRot

Description

Set the rotation of an object on the X, Y and Z axis.

NameDescription
playeridThe ID of the player whose player-object to rotate.
objectidThe ID of the player-object to rotate.
Float:RotXThe X rotation to set.
Float:RotYThe Y rotation to set.
Float:RotZThe Z rotation to set.

Returns

1: The function executed successfully.

0: The function failed to execute.

Examples

SetPlayerObjectRot(playerid, objectid, RotX, RotY, RotZ);

Notes

tip

To smoothly rotate an object, see MovePlayerObject.

Related Functions

  • CreatePlayerObject: Create an object for only one player.
  • DestroyPlayerObject: Destroy a player object.
  • IsValidPlayerObject: Checks if a certain player object is vaild.
  • MovePlayerObject: Move a player object.
  • StopPlayerObject: Stop a player object from moving.
  • SetPlayerObjectPos: Set the position of a player object.
  • GetPlayerObjectPos: Locate a player object.
  • GetPlayerObjectRot: Check the rotation of a player object.
  • AttachPlayerObjectToPlayer: Attach a player object to a player.
  • CreateObject: Create an object.
  • DestroyObject: Destroy an object.
  • IsValidObject: Checks if a certain object is vaild.
  • MoveObject: Move an object.
  • StopObject: Stop an object from moving.
  • SetObjectPos: Set the position of an object.
  • SetObjectRot: Set the rotation of an object.
  • GetObjectPos: Locate an object.
  • GetObjectRot: Check the rotation of an object.
  • AttachObjectToPlayer: Attach an object to a player.

Community

  • Discord
  • Instagram
  • Twitter
  • Twitch
  • YouTube
  • Facebook
  • VK

More

  • SA-MP
  • Blog
  • GitHub